python生成表格
时间: 2023-07-05 22:13:22 浏览: 110
你可以使用Python的pandas库来生成表格。以下是一个简单的示例代码:
```python
import pandas as pd
# 创建一个字典,包含表格中的数据
data = {'姓名': ['张三', '李四', '王五'],
'年龄': [20, 25, 30],
'性别': ['男', '男', '女']}
# 将字典转换成DataFrame格式
df = pd.DataFrame(data)
# 打印表格
print(df)
```
输出结果如下:
```
姓名 年龄 性别
0 张三 20 男
1 李四 25 男
2 王五 30 女
```
你可以根据需要修改数据和表格的样式。如果需要将表格保存到文件中,可以使用`to_csv()`方法。例如:
```python
df.to_csv('mytable.csv', index=False, encoding='utf-8')
```
这将把表格保存到名为`mytable.csv`的文件中,不包含行索引,并使用UTF-8编码。
相关问题
python生成表格的代码
以下是使用Python生成表格的示例代码:
```python
import pandas as pd
# 创建一个包含表格数据的DataFrame
data = {'姓名': ['张三', '李四', '王五'],
'年龄': [20, 25, 30],
'性别': ['男', '男', '女']}
df = pd.DataFrame(data)
# 输出表格
print(df)
```
运行上述代码将输出以下表格:
```
姓名 年龄 性别
0 张三 20 男
1 李四 25 男
2 王五 30 女
```
你也可以使用其他Python库(如Matplotlib、Plotly等)生成更加复杂的表格。
python 生成xls表格
可以使用 pandas 库来生成 xls 表格,具体操作可以参考以下代码:
```python
import pandas as pd
# 创建数据
data = {'姓名': ['张三', '李四', '王五'], '年龄': [20, 25, 30], '性别': ['男', '女', '男']}
# 转换为 DataFrame
df = pd.DataFrame(data)
# 生成 xls 表格
df.to_excel('example.xls', index=False)
```
以上代码会生成一个名为 `example.xls` 的 xls 表格,其中包含了 `data` 中的数据。
阅读全文